Output 8f07ec3bbf217525ab27fc05047ca598ba623c405909779c5d7a5a0e0ee98790: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801426bd8e3fbecb24f05778692b9a1d186eafdd OP_EQUAL
address
3DNEZEhW6jzX3UJwfLK6298uEkpQ3pFZcX
transaction
8f07ec3bbf217525ab27fc05047ca598ba623c405909779c5d7a5a0e0ee98790
spent
true